As Assistant Restaurant Manager what you’ll be doing

  • Fabulous full time role, 45 hours per week working 5 out of 7 days on flexible rota.
  • Supporting the Food & Beverage operation in the day to day running of our Restaurant, indoor and outdoor function spaces, Dining Domes and wonderful terrace. This role will focus on our sunny terrace and La Taberna alfresco dining experience
  • Managing a team of engaged individuals working a long side our senior restaurant team across multiple outlets including cross training and knowledge growth to increase retention and attract new talent
  • Focus on the experience, whether that be your team members or our guests, we want everyone to return with a smile and a little splash of zest
  • With your high levels of communication skills, passion for the ultimate guest experience and potential for managing the team effectively, you will be instrumental in laying a ‘path of success’ for our restaurant team
  • Take pride in setting and maintaining the recognised standards in the restaurant while looking after your guests and supporting team training on the service journey and ensuring industry and legal standards are fulfilled for health and safety and allergen awareness
